### Runbook: Account Recovery — RateMirror Parity Checker

Reviewer note: this fragment covers the admin account recovery path for RateMirror, our hotel rate-parity checker. When the primary admin is locked out, the recovery flow must verify the requester against the on-call roster in Opsline before issuing a reset token. Please check that the token TTL is enforced at 15 minutes and that the audit event fires before, not after, credential rotation. The final step prompts the operator to enter the standing recovery passphrase, which is:

strongbox words: zordor-quenax

The Farecraft rules engine evaluates shipping-fee rules in priority order and returns the first match. Contractors should test rules against the staging evaluator before promoting them. All requests to the staging evaluator must authenticate as the shared integration service account; include the key below in the request header.

gateway credential: kto23_LX9A4ys6i4nzHtpOLNLodKK

# Env Vars: Planner Regression Mitigation

After the query planner regression in Corvid DB 9.3, Fernwell's release builds must pin the legacy planner until the patched build ships. Set `CORVID_PLANNER_MODE=legacy` in the release env file and confirm it with the preflight check before tagging. The planner override endpoint requires authentication, so the release env file also needs the planner override token on the next line.

env line for kahof-fajeg: ARCHIVE_KEY3=397

# Break-Glass Access — Perchlight Kiosk Watchdog

The Perchlight kiosk fleet runs a watchdog service that restarts the shell app if it hangs. Break-glass access is required only when the watchdog itself is wedged and remote management is unreachable. Physical access to the kiosk's service port is mandatory; the procedure is logged by the enclosure sensor. Disabling the watchdog requires the offline recovery console, which unlocks only with the passphrase recorded below.

unlock words, yadup-yagef: zorael-druix